Exceptional Employees help to make a business

No business can prosper without good, committed employees. And, occasionally, we all come across exceptional people who work with great enthusiasm and effectiveness for their company, acting as an inspiration to others. They are the ones who make a real difference and help their company to thrive and compete well in the tough business environment which faces us all.
As mentioned in past Newsletters, Brentwood Chamber of Commerce has decided to introduce an ”Employee Recognition Award” to recognise such exceptional people, nominated by their companies for services beyond the norm, for going, as you might say, ‘the extra mile’. The first such awards were made at Chamber’s Christmas networking lunch in December 2007. Our picture shows the two recipients; Katy Hilton from the Music Shop, Ropers Yard, Brentwood – nominated by the business owner, Sue Page (second from left): the other is Colin Miers who works for Brentwood Home Improvement agency, Anchor Staying Put. Presenting the awards, Rob Bristow, Vice-Chairman of Brentwood Chamber of Commerce (far right of the picture), said of Katy “she is to be commended for her level of commitment and effort to her job…. Katy embodies the kind of service that shoppers in Brentwood have come to enjoy”. Commenting on Colin’s award, Rob said “we are delighted to honour Colin in this way as his service to the community has clearly been outstanding….we wish him and Anchor Staying Put a very successful continued future in their care for the elderly and disabled”.
